The BTEC Extended Diploma in Sport is a vocational course which looks at different areas of employment within the sports sector. It offers a solid foundation in the various aspects of sport and enables you to develop essential skills required for gaining employment or progressing further in education. There are two pathways on the course; Coaching Development and Fitness or Performance and Excellence. Decisions regarding pathway choice will be discussed in more detail at interview. The course in made up of 19 units and looks at a variety of different areas of sport including: Coaching in sport and assessing sports performance Fitness principles including fitness tests and designing training programmes Injuries within sport and sports massage Sports psychology and nutrition Sports business and event organisation Sports development and issues in sport The course is delivered in a practical manner with assessments ranging from written reports, portfolios and posters to verbal assessments, presentations and practical assessment. The course offers a range of trips and team building activities as part of the induction, main course programme and assessments on some units. In the past, trips have included outdoor activities such as paintballing, climbing and canoeing and indoor sports such as laser tag, bowling and ice skating. Students will study towards the Community Sports Leaders Award with the opportunity to progress onto the Higher Sports Leader Award. As a vocational course we encourage students to gain as many additional qualifications as possible to support applications for Higher Education and further job opportunities.
